Claims Counsel
About the role
The Claims team at Coalition stands apart for our outstanding level of client service and active and intelligent handling of claims for our insureds. Coalition is committed to identifying and managing cyber risk for our insureds and our claims team helps to manage the impact and outcomes of cyber events. As we continue to expand, we are seeking an experienced attorney to join our cyber claims team and to lend a hand in handling first-party and third-party matters under complex primary Cyber, Tech, and Media policies. You will also provide support to the underwriting and actuarial teams and oversee the activities of a variety of vendors, including breach counsel, defense counsel, and the broader incident response team for Coalition and its partner carriers.
Responsibilities
Handle the intake of cyber events, including the coordination with breach counsel, forensic investigators and other vendors
Evaluate full pending of claims in connection with the posting and recommending accurate reserves
Maintain accurate file documentation/information in our claims system
Analyze liability and damage data in connection with complex claims
Maintain appropriate file documentation
Analyze insurance coverage issues
Prepare coverage letters
Proactively manage and track work done by third-party vendors and service providers
Maintain and develop relationships with brokers, risk managers, and a variety of firms and vendors
Collaborate with insureds on resolution strategies and identification of settlement opportunities
Provide data and analytic based-informational support to our actuarial and underwriting partners.
Provide support to Coalition’s business development team in marketing efforts and the placement of new and renewal business
Liaise with partner carriers on a regular basis
Skills and Qualifications
Juris Doctor degree
Willingness to promptly acquire adjusting licenses (existing individual CA licensure is a plus)
2+ years of experience handling Cyber, Tech, Media claims (other Executive Risk claims experience is a plus)
Demonstrated ability to work as part of a team, interact with others, meet deadlines, and successfully perform in a fast-paced, changing work environment
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
Team-oriented with ability to excel in a collegial environment but work independently
